Admissions

Application Requirements

To be eligible for admission to the Master of Arts in Mathematics Education program, applicants must have a bachelor's degree in mathematics or a related field with a minimum GPA of 3.0. Applicants must also have completed at least 18 units of mathematics coursework, including calculus, linear algebra, and statistics. In addition, applicants must submit a statement of purpose, a resume, and three letters of recommendation. The program typically admits 15-20 students per year.

Scholarships

The California State University, Dominguez Hills offers a variety of scholarships for students pursuing a master's degree in mathematics education. These scholarships are awarded based on academic merit, financial need, and other criteria. Some of the scholarships that are available include the CSUDH President's Scholarship, the CSUDH Alumni Scholarship, and the CSUDH Foundation Scholarship.
